Key Points
Optimal control strategies significantly enhance the spread of information, promoting better outcomes.
Achieving a marked reduction in misinformation spread is possible through adaptive control methods.
The approach relies on physics-informed neural networks (PINNs) to accurately simulate complex dynamics of rumor spread.
Implications include potential applications in managing communication strategies during public emergencies.
